Exopolysaccharide Production Is Influenced by Sugars, N-Acylhomoserine Lactone, and Transcriptional Regulators RcsA and RcsB, but Does Not Affect Pathogenicity in the Plant Pathogen Pantoea ananatis

Pantoea ananatis SK-1 produced EPS by AHL-mediated quorum sensing on an LB agar plate containing glucose, fructose, and sucrose. rcsA and rcsB mutants did not produce EPS with or without AHLs and with or without sugars, but they induced necrotic symptoms in onion leaves. These results indicate that EPS production does not relate to the pathogenicity of SK-1.
